Caramel Apple Shots

By Laura | Laura the Gastronaut

Prep Time: 5 minutes | Total Time: 5 minutes
Yield: 4 shots

These bright green shots taste just like caramel apples especially when the shot glasses are given a caramel rim. They are made with both apple cider and sour apple schnapps for the ultimate apple flavor. The caramel flavor comes from the caramel vodka and the delicious caramel sauce rim. These caramel apple shots are perfect for Halloween and fall!

Ingredients

• 4 ounces sour apple schnapps
• 2 ounces caramel vodka
• 2 ounces apple cider
• 1/2 ounce lemon juice
• Optional: caramel sauce, for rim of shot glasses

Instructions

➊ In a cocktail shaker, combine all of the ingredients with a couple of ice cubes. Shake for about 10 seconds until chilled.
➋ If desired, dip rims of each shot glass into caramel sauce.
➌ Strain the mixture into 4 shot glasses, and enjoy!
